Description

This dataset serves as a comprehensive longitudinal news corpus for the Tajik language, sourced from Radio Ozodi (ozodi.org), the Tajik service of Radio Free Europe/Radio Liberty (RFE/RL). Spanning from June 2000 to March 2026, the corpus contains 166,721 unique articles, totaling over 20 million tokens across Tajik and Russian texts. The dataset captures the historical record and linguistic evolution of the region over a quarter-century, intentionally preserving the small subset of Russian articles published alongside the core Tajik content while discarding negligible English fragments. The files are formatted as plain text with YAML front-matter metadata, making them ready for linguistic analysis, search indexing, and cultural preservation research.

RFE/RL Tajik News Text Corpus (2000–2026)

Overview

This corpus was extracted from the archives of Radio Ozodi (ozodi.org), the Tajik Service of Radio Free Europe/Radio Liberty.

Statistics

  • Total Articles: 166721

  • Time Period: 2000-06 to 2026-03

  • Languages:

    • Tajik (tg): 164874 articles (~19750467 tokens)

    • Russian (ru): 1847 articles (~471792 tokens)

Note on Processing & Multilingual Content:

  • Language Detection: The language of each article was identified automatically using the pycld2 Python package (version 0.42).

  • Multilingual Articles: As a multilingual project, Russian articles published alongside the Tajik content have been preserved (ozodi.ru.txt) as potential parallel texts or regional supplementary coverage. Small fragments of English text detected by the parser have been discarded as negligible.

  • Paragraph Structure: Paragraph breaks from the original HTML were preserved to the extent possible.

  • Formatting: Text has been wrapped at 80 characters for easier inspection in terminal environments. This wrapping is done strictly on whitespace; no words were split or chunked apart.

Data Format

The dataset is provided as text files based on detected language:

  • ozodi.tg.txt

  • ozodi.ru.txt

Inside the files, each article is delimited by a YAML Front Matter block containing metadata, followed by the full article text.

Metadata Fields

  • url: The canonical URL of the original article.

  • title: The headline of the article.

  • date: Publication date (ISO 8601 format: YYYY-MM-DD).

  • script: The writing system used (cyrl for Tajik/Russian).

  • lang: The detected language code (tg or ru).
